G.
Douglas Hatler, PGK, FICF, LUTCF
A Jersey City native, G. Douglas Hatler, PGK, FICF, LUTCF joined the Order in 1972. He is a member of the Wallington Council #3644 for which he served as Grand Knight twice. Doug has been a dedicated participant in state and local membership and charity drives. He is a past president of the New Jersey Association of Fraternal Insurance Counsellors (NJFIC) and for the past 10 years has served as the chairperson for the Bergen Federation Golf Tournament. Under his stewardship, the Federation has been a significant donor to several charitable causes totaling over $30,000. Members of St. Mary Parish, Doug and his wife Betty reside in Rutherford, NJ along with their two children, Craig and Lauren. Doug received his B.S. in economics from the University of Tennessee in 1972 and his M.B.A. from Farleigh Dickenson University in 1982.

Donald L. Ulisse, PGK, FICF
Don Ulisse, PGK, FICF joined the Order in 1995, as a member of Immaculate Conception Council #9021 in Norwood. Having risen through multiple officer positions, he served as Grand Knight from 1999-2001, leading his Council to Star Council status. In 1997 he took his 4th Degree Exemplification as a member of the Msgr. Charles G. McCorristin Assembly, where he presently serves as Faithful Captain. Don has been very active in service to the Order. In 2000 he formed Norwood Council’s 2nd Degree team on which Don still serves as captain. In 2000 Don also joined the officer corps of the Bergen County Federation, he served as it’s president in Columbian year 2004-2005. Don became a Knights of Columbus field agent in 2001. In addition, he has served two years as state chairman of the Parish Rosary Recitation program, as well as currently serving as archdiocesan chairman of the Pride In Our Priests program. Don lives in Harrington Park with wife Irene and son Daniel. He is a parishioner of Our Lady of Victories Church where he served as president of the parish council and director of the lectors program.

Jerryl Pulis
Jerryl comes to us with a background as an English teacher and high school coach. He taught in Midland Park and the Bergen Technical High School, and also got some early experience teaching in parochial elementary schools in Cresskill and Emerson. He has resided in Westwood, NJ all of his life.
